Fire protection serves to protect a building from fire. There are two types of fire protection systems- active and passive. An active fire protection system uses water to extinguish the fire. These include gaseous fire suppression systems, wet fire sprinkler systems, dry fire sprinkler systems, foam fire suppression systems, etc. They actively suppress or extinguish the fire primarily with the help of water or chemicals or foam. They are designed to protect property and its occupants during a fire.

Wet fire sprinkler system The wet fire sprinkler system employs automatic sprinklers attached to pipes connected to a water supply. The water discharge takes place immediately through the pipe in an event of a fire. Only those sprinklers which are operated by heat discharges water during a fire.
Dry pipe system This type of pipe system employs automatic sprinklers attached to a pipe system containing air or nitrogen. When released, the water flows into the piping system and discharges water from those sprinklers operated by fire. It forms a part of an active fire protection in Ireland.
Special hazard fire protection system These are designed to quickly detect any heat condition. They are more appropriate when the sprinkler system doesn’t operate and offer unique solution. They are mostly used in data centers, telecommunication, power generation, machinery spaces, healthcare facilities, etc.
Dry chemical fire suppression systems This type of fire protection system uses dry chemical powder to extinguish a fire. Most of the dry chemical fire suppression system make use of a large tank that is filled with the powder. When the system is activated, the valve opens and dry powder is released to extinguish the fire.
Gaseous fire suppression system This type of system uses inert gases and chemical agents to suppress or extinguish a fire. It is designed to extinguish a fire, not only to suppress it. These are used when water, powder systems are not effective to extinguish a fire. They are considered to be the “cleanest” extinguishing system.
Foam fire suppression system A foam fire suppression system is a type of wet sprinkler system that combines both water and fire to extinguish a fire. It is used for extinguishing large scale fire and extinguishes it with incredible efficiency. This fire protection in Irelandseparates the fuel from the oxygen to extinguish a fire.
